marioparty4/include/datadir_enum.h
2024-02-03 16:07:35 -06:00

23 lines
No EOL
382 B
C

#ifndef DATADIR_ENUM
#define DATADIR_ENUM
#define DATADIR_DEFINE(name, path) DATADIR_ID_##name,
enum {
#include "datadir_table.h"
DATADIR_ID_MAX
};
#undef DATADIR_DEFINE
#define DATADIR_DEFINE(name, path) DATADIR_##name = (DATADIR_ID_##name) << 16,
enum {
#include "datadir_table.h"
};
#undef DATADIR_DEFINE
#define DATA_MAKE_NUM(dir, file) ((dir)+(file))
#endif